Why are these roses special?

To understand the differences between cultures, you need to study the characteristics of each of them. Hybrid tea roses are bred by crossing.Thanks to this, breeders were able to obtain a unique combination of large buds and a pleasant aroma of remontant varieties. They have beautiful shades of the tea group. The first plant from this group appeared in 1865. Its author is the French breeder Andre Guillot.

The characteristic features of this type include the following:

  • large flowers;
  • correct goblet shape of the bud;
  • attractive shades;
  • the only bud on the stem.

These varieties do not bloom immediately, which makes it possible to admire them for a long time. This group is mainly grown for sale. Such flowers remain fresh and beautiful for a long time. They suffer from cutting. In most cases, classic bouquets are made from hybrid tea varieties.

Floribunda is another popular variety of roses that is often found in summer cottages. It is created on the basis of musk, hybrid tea and polyanthus varieties. Selection work began in the twenties of the last century. However, this species officially appeared in 1952. It is worth noting that scientists still do not stop their experiments, offering flower growers interesting and original options.

The main advantage of floribunda is its abundant flowering. At the same time, the plant is characterized by not too large buds. However, they consist of several flowers, which helps to obtain a very spectacular crop.

The distinctive features of this variety include the following:

  • long flowering - lasts from June to the end of October;
  • variety of shapes and shades;
  • lush flowering - 8-9 flowers may be present on 1 stem;
  • low maintenance requirements;
  • no need for mandatory pruning in the fall.

Main differences

The varieties of crops under consideration are characterized by a number of distinctive features.

By aroma

Hybrid tea roses are characterized by a bright and rich aroma. It often has spicy or citrus notes. Either way, the scent is inviting and spicy. Floribundas lack a distinct aroma. You can feel it only in the evening - after sunset. Some representatives of this variety have no aroma at all.

By appearance

Hybrid tea varieties are characterized by stems of reddish-burgundy shades, which makes them even more decorative. Such plants look more elegant than floribunda. It, in turn, is characterized by rich inflorescences. Due to this, the bushes look more lush.

Hybrid tea varieties are characterized by the presence of 1 flower per branch. In floribunda this number reaches 5-10. The culture is characterized by active development and after some time many side branches appear on the bushes.

By size

Hybrid tea rose bushes are always strong and powerful. They almost always exceed 1 meter in height. Floribunda is characterized by lush bushes. However, they do not reach 1 meter in height. However, individual shoots exceed a meter in length. This occurs if they are not trimmed for a long time.

Subtleties of care

Both types of plants require regular watering with warm water. It is recommended to feed them with nitrogen and phosphorus-potassium fertilizers. After flowering, the bushes should be pruned. In addition, it is recommended to cover crops for the winter.

The main difference between floribunda is that it is forbidden to prune it in the autumn. This plant is considered easier to care for, as it is characterized by resistance to disease. Hybrid tea varieties do not withstand frost well.Therefore, they are not grown in areas where the winter temperature is less than -18 degrees.

Hybrid teas and floribunda are popular varieties that are characterized by a number of differences. They relate to visual signs, aroma and care features.
